MMP-13, Human (His)
The MMP-13 protein plays a role in the degradation of extracellular matrix proteins, especially fibrillar collagen, fibronectin, TNC, and ACAN. It cleaves triple-helical collagen, preferentially cleaves type II collagen, and can also target other collagen types. MMP-13 Protein, Human (His) is the recombinant human-derived MMP-13 protein, expressed by E. coli , with N-6*His labeled tag.
